Home Additions in Serenity Bay

Room additions, second stories, and Florida rooms built to carry the same hurricane loads as new construction — an engineered continuous load path, impact-rated openings, and a foundation tied into your existing slab. We engineer the structure, handle the FBC permit, and stand for the inspections so the new square footage is legal, insurable, and storm-ready.
